Sensory-specific satiety is intact in amnesics who eat multiple meals
Suzanne Higgs1, Amy C Williamson, Pia Rotshtein
1University of Birmingham, Edgbaston, Birmingham B152TT, England. s.higgs.1@bham.ac.uk
Abstract:
What is the relationship between memory and appetite? We explored this question by examining preferences for recently consumed food in patients with amnesia. Although the patients were unable to remember having eaten, and were inclined to eat multiple meals, we found that sensory-specific satiety was intact in these patients. The data suggest that sensory-specific satiety can occur in the absence of explicit memory for having eaten and that impaired sensory-specific satiety does not underlie the phenomenon of multiple-meal eating in amnesia. Overeating in amnesia may be due to disruption of learned control by physiological aftereffects of a recent meal or to problems utilizing internal cues relating to nutritional state.

Amnesia
The severity and duration of memory loss vary depending on the type and underlying cause. Amnesia is classified into two main types: retrograde and anterograde.
Retrograde amnesia is marked by the loss of memories formed before the onset of the condition. Patients may recall distant past events but often forget those occurring shortly before the incident.
